
Orlov
Orlov, distinct from the better-known Orlov Paris, is a small Slovak fragrance and personal-care label trading from the village of Orlov in the country's northeast. The brand is municipal-adjacent rather than couture, with production closer to a regional cosmetics workshop than a maison de parfum. Public documentation is thin: the catalogue surfaces mainly through local Slovak retail and the obecorlov.sk domain, and there is no English-language editorial or perfumer credit on record. Compositions appear to lean toward accessible, designer-style profiles for a domestic audience. The label is best understood as a Central European lifestyle brand using fragrance as one product line among others; wearers outside Slovakia will rarely encounter it, and confusion with the French gem-themed Orlov Paris is the most useful thing to flag.
